Governor Hochul Vetoes Subway Crew Bill, Cites Costs

Story summary
  • New York Governor Kathy Hochul vetoed a bill requiring two-person subway crews, citing a $10 million annual cost.
  • The measure passed the Assembly and Senate with overwhelming support but faced budget watchdog opposition.
  • Transit Workers Union leaders said current contracts already guarantee two-person crews on many trains.
  • Advocacy groups praised the veto as aligning with global transit practices.
  • Hochul cited a significant drop in subway crime to justify the decision.
